Standard mobile communications determines the technologies used and the principle of building mobile communication networks. Mobile communication networks are usually divided into analog (NMT, AMPS) and digital (D-AMPS, GSM, CDMA, WCDMA, UMTS), as well as classified by generation (generation) stages of development of the standards themselves.
GSM(Global System for Mobile Communications) - the most popular and widespread standard cellular communication second generation 2G virtually all over the world. In our country, as in most European countries, frequencies of 900 and 1800 MHz are allocated for this standard. In the countries of the American continent, it is customary to use the frequencies 850 and 1900 MHz.
The widespread introduction of GSM to replace obsolete analog networks has made it possible to significantly expand the subscriber base and the range of services provided, making cellular communications widely available. However, the specificity of GSM limits the currently demanded services based on high-speed Internet access.

3G standards:

3G(Third Generation) - Third generation mobile communication technologies based on packet data transmission. Third-generation 3G networks operate, as a rule, in the range of about 2 GHz, allowing you to transfer data at a speed comparable to a dedicated home Internet. In addition to standard voice telephony services, 3G networks are initially focused on various multimedia services, such as video telephony and video conferencing, online browsing on-air television and movies, listening to Internet radio, etc. The most common third-generation communication standard is WCDMA (UMTS), which operates in most European countries, incl. in Russia and CIS countries.

SIM generation:

Each new generation of SIM cards is smaller than the previous one. Format Mini-SIM(2FF) appeared in the 1990s and is now used mainly in simple push-button phones. Cards Micro SIM(3FF) have been used in smartphones since 2003 to this day. Nano SIM(4FF) - the most compact map installed in modern smart devices. eSIM is a chip built into the device on which you can write a virtual SIM card. This format not supported by all carriers.

Accumulator battery:

The difference in the chemical composition of batteries determines their physical and consumer parameters.
Ni-Cd(Nickel - Cadmium) and Ni-Mh(Nickel - Metal Hydride) batteries are quite heavy and bulky. Being not completely discharged before recharging, they are prone to loss of capacity (memory effect), and therefore require periodic prophylaxis (charge-discharge, the so-called training).
Against, Li-Ion(Lithium - Ion) and Li-Pol(Lithium - Polymer) batteries do not have these disadvantages. However, they lose their charge faster at low temperatures and have poor drop resistance. Unpretentiousness in maintenance and comparable smaller sizes and weight were decisive factors for their active use.

NFC module:

NFC(Near Field Communication, "near field communication") - a wireless communication technology that allows the exchange of data between devices located at a distance of up to 20 centimeters. There are many possible applications of NFC technology: transferring files between devices, connecting to accessories, using the device as a payment card, etc.

Display and keyboard

Display type:

TFT IPS- High-quality liquid crystal matrix. It has wide viewing angles, one of the best indicators of color reproduction quality and contrast among all those used in the production of displays for portable equipment.
Super AMOLED- if a conventional AMOLED screen uses several layers, between which there is an air gap, then in Super AMOLED there is only one such touch layer without air gaps. This allows you to achieve greater screen brightness with the same power consumption.
Super AMOLED HD- differs from Super AMOLED in a higher resolution, thanks to which it is possible to achieve 1280x720 pixels on a mobile phone screen.
Super AMOLED plus- this is a new generation of Super AMOLED displays, different from the previous use more subpixels in a conventional RGB matrix. The new displays are 18% thinner and 18% brighter than the older PenTile displays.
AMOLED- an improved version of OLED technology. The main advantages of the technology are significantly reduced power consumption, the ability to display a large color gamut, a smaller thickness and the ability of the display to bend a little without the risk of breaking.
retina- display with a high pixel density, designed specifically for Apple technology. Pixel density per Retina displays is such that individual pixels are indistinguishable to the eye at a normal distance from the screen. This provides the highest image detail and greatly improves the overall viewing experience.
Super Retina HD- The display is made using OLED technology. The pixel density is 458 PPI, the contrast ratio reaches 1,000,000:1. The display has an extended color gamut and unrivaled color accuracy. Pixels in the corners of the display are anti-aliased at the sub-pixel level, so borders don't distort and look smooth. Super Retina HD reinforcement layer is 50% thicker. Breaking the screen will be harder.
Super LCD is the next generation of LCD technology and features improved features compared to earlier LCD displays. Screens have not only wide viewing angles and better color reproduction, but also reduced power consumption.
TFT- A common type of liquid crystal displays. With the help of an active matrix, controlled by thin-film transistors, it is possible to significantly increase the speed of the display, as well as the contrast and clarity of the image.
OLED- organic electroluminescent display. Consists of a special thin-film polymer that emits light under the influence of an electric field. This type of display has a large margin of brightness and consumes very little power.

bluetooth module:

Technology Bluetooth implements a wireless connection of devices over a secure radio channel in the 2.4 GHz band. The technology is based on the use of profiles (services) as tools for performing specific tasks (audio gateway, hands-free, headset, file transfer, dial-up networking, serial port, etc.). Each profile contains a specific set of operations and defines the possible areas of interaction between devices.
With a Bluetooth connection, devices can be up to ten meters apart, and therefore, the development of wireless accessories is one of the prerogatives of this technology.

Support bluetooth stereo:

bluetooth stereo or A2DP(Advanced Audio Distribution Profile) - a Bluetooth profile or service designed to transmit music in stereo sound. Devices that support the A2DP profile allow you to listen to music using wireless bluetooth headphones, thereby relieving you of the limitations of traditional wired stereo headsets.

Sensors:

Accelerometer(or G-sensor) - device position sensor in space. As a main function, the accelerometer is used to automatic change orientation of the image on the display (vertical or horizontal). Also, the G-sensor is used as a pedometer, it can be controlled by various functions of the device by turning or shaking.
Gyroscope- a sensor that measures the angles of rotation relative to a fixed coordinate system. Able to measure rotation angles in several planes simultaneously. The gyroscope together with the accelerometer allows you to determine the position of the device in space with high accuracy. In devices that use only accelerometers, measurement accuracy is lower, especially when moving quickly. Also, the capabilities of the gyroscope can be used in modern games For mobile devices.
Light sensor- sensor, thanks to which the optimal values ​​​​of brightness and contrast are set for given level illumination. The presence of the sensor allows you to increase the operating time of the device from the battery.
Proximity sensor- a sensor that detects when the device is close to the face during a call, turns off the backlight and locks the screen, preventing accidental pressing. The presence of the sensor allows you to increase the operating time of the device from the battery.
Geomagnetic sensor- a sensor for determining the direction of the world in which the device is directed. Tracks the orientation of the device in space relative to the Earth's magnetic poles. The information received from the sensor is used in mapping programs for orientation in the area.
Atmospheric pressure sensor- sensor for accurate measurement of atmospheric pressure. Is a part GPS systems, allows you to determine the height above sea level and speed up positioning.

Satellite navigation:

GPS(Global Positioning System - global positioning system) - satellite system navigation that measures distance, time, speed and determines the location of objects anywhere on the Earth. The system was developed, implemented and operated by the US Department of Defense. The basic principle of using the system is to determine the location by measuring the distances to the object from points with known coordinates - satellites. The distance is calculated from the signal propagation delay time from sending it by the satellite to receiving it by the GPS receiver antenna.
GLONASS(Global Navigation Satellite System) - Soviet and Russian satellite navigation system, developed by order of the USSR Ministry of Defense. The principle of measurement is similar to the American system GPS navigation. GLONASS is intended for operational navigation and time support for ground, sea, air and space-based users. The main difference from the GPS system is that the GLONASS satellites in their orbital movement do not have resonance (synchronism) with the Earth's rotation, which provides them with greater stability.

Galaxy Tab A 8.0 design

The new Galaxy Tab A 8.0 follows Samsung's design trends. It is thin and light, and for the most illegible eyes, it even looks like. Unlike Apple tablet however, the Galaxy Tab A 8.0 is wrapped in plastic.

Its smooth back panel fits comfortably in your fingers, and the rounded edges make it easy to grip the tablet, but low quality plastic returns cheap appearance. At 7.4mm thick, the tablet weighs 313 grams, and it's not the thinnest or lightest tablet, but it's definitely not bad.

On the top right edge of the tablet, you'll find the power button and volume rocker, with a microSD slot underneath. At the same time, at the bottom of the tablet is a microUSB port, headphone jack and one speaker.

Galaxy Tab A 8.0 review: At the bottom is one sad, lonely speaker.

Since this is an 8-inch tablet, being able to hold it with one hand becomes a design advantage of the compact model. I didn't experience any problems using the tablet with one hand during the review, but people with small hands may have trouble trying to wrap around the Galaxy Tab A.

PeculiaritiesGalaxy Tab A 8.0

Samsung Galaxy Tab A 8.0 is equipped with a panel with a resolution of 1024 x 768 pixels with an aspect ratio of 4:3. Unfortunately, the text can be displayed oddly, although this does not complicate reading, just a harsh reminder that you are not using best tablet On the market.

Galaxy Tab A 8.0 review: HD video looks sharp enough on a tablet screen.

Luckily, HD video still looks sharp and crisp. However, fans streaming video should think twice about choosing this Samsung tablet. The 4:3 aspect ratio is wrapped in black bars at the top and bottom of the video, which means the picture doesn't fill the screen, and the lone speaker, in turn, offers exceptionally dull sound. Also, since the speaker is on the bottom, it's easy to block it - although that might be for the best.

Hardcore gamers should also refrain from the Galaxy Tab A 8.0. During Samsung review Galaxy Tab A 8.0, we tested the tablet in 3DMark, where it showed the lowest result, losing to almost all comparable models. I didn't experience any problems while playing on the Galaxy Tab A 8.0, but tests show that for heavy games it's worth finding a better tablet.

The standard pair of cameras on the Galaxy Tab A 8.0 are pretty decent sensors for this price range. The rear camera is represented by a 5-megapixel sensor, and the front-facing 2-megapixel. The cameras take clean photos with the right focus, but sharpness at full resolution is lacking, as is color saturation.

According to Samsung, the Galaxy Tab A 8.0 should last around 13 hours, based on the review we tend to agree. On a full charge, alternating between moderate and heavy use, I got two days without a charge. We tested it as part of a review, looping local video in airplane mode, and the Galaxy Tab A 8.0 lasted an average of 11 hours.

Review Galaxy Tab A8.0: The rear camera disappoints with lackluster color saturation.

Summing up:

Samsung releases more tablets a year than any other manufacturer, so we're pleased to finally see a couple of lower models with affordable prices that match the quality of the tablets.

In comparison, the Acer Iconia Tab 8 has much more a high resolution screen (1920 x 1200 pixels) and is equipped with a useful Micro HDMI port. Regardless, the Galaxy Tab A (apart from demanding gaming) consistently handles most tasks, making it a more practical choice for everyday use.

Specific Absorption Rate (SAR)

SAR levels refer to the amount of electromagnetic radiation absorbed by the human body while using a mobile device.

Head SAR (EU)

The SAR level indicates the maximum number electromagnetic radiation that the human body is exposed to when holding a mobile device next to the ear in a conversation position. In Europe, the maximum allowable SAR value for mobile devices is limited to 2 W/kg per 10 grams of human tissue. This standard has been established by CENELEC in accordance with IEC standards following the 1998 ICNIRP guidelines.

0.108 W/kg (watt per kilogram)
Body SAR (EU)

The SAR level indicates the maximum amount of electromagnetic radiation that the human body is exposed to when holding a mobile device at hip level. The maximum allowed SAR value for mobile devices in Europe is 2 W/kg per 10 grams of human tissue. This standard has been established by CENELEC following the 1998 ICNIRP guidelines and IEC standards.

0.899 W/kg (watt per kilogram)
Head SAR (US)

The SAR level indicates the maximum amount of electromagnetic radiation that the human body is exposed to when holding a mobile device near the ear. The maximum value used in the US is 1.6 W/kg per gram of human tissue. Mobile devices in the US are controlled by the CTIA and the FCC conducts tests and sets their SAR values.

0.933 W/kg (watt per kilogram)
Body SAR (US)

The SAR level indicates the maximum amount of electromagnetic radiation that the human body is exposed to when holding a mobile device at hip level. The highest acceptable SAR value in the US is 1.6 W/kg per gram of human tissue. This value is set by the FCC, and the CTIA controls whether mobile devices comply with this standard.

1.521 W/kg (watt per kilogram)
